Month 1: Building Your Digital Foundations
Securing Your Brand Identity
Get your domain name locked down and protect your brand identity online. Set up that Google Business Profile – don't skip the photos and complete info, as this becomes your local calling card. Commission your website through professional web design services and grab a proper business email address using your domain. Trust me, nobody takes Gmail seriously for business.
Essential Brand Protection Steps
Register your business name across major social media platforms, even if you won't use them immediately. This prevents competitors from claiming your brand identity later. Consider trademark protection for your business name and logo if you haven't already.

Going Live with Purpose
Time to go live! Launch with at least five solid pages that really show off what you do. Install Google Analytics and Search Console right away – you'll want this data from day one. Submit your sitemap to Google and get listed on Yell, Thomson Local, plus any directories that matter in your industry. Think of it as planting seeds across the internet.
Technical SEO Foundations
Your website needs to load quickly and work perfectly on mobile devices. Set up proper URL structures and meta descriptions for each page. These technical elements help search engines discover and rank your content effectively as you're building online presence.
Month 3: Reviews and Content Strategy
Building Social Proof
Now's the time to start collecting Google reviews. Don't be shy about asking – happy customers usually don't mind helping out. Publish your first blog post using content marketing best practices as your guide. Share everything on social media and take your first proper look at those analytics. These numbers become your baseline.
Review Collection Systems
Create a simple system for requesting reviews after successful projects. Send follow-up emails with direct links to your Google Business Profile. Respond professionally to all reviews, both positive and negative, to show you value customer feedback.
Month 4: Strengthening Local SEO
Consistency is Key
Here's something that trips up loads of businesses: make sure your name, address, and phone number match everywhere online. Seriously, Google notices these inconsistencies. Get listed in local directories and industry platforms that actually matter. Post weekly updates on your Google Business Profile – it keeps you visible in local searches.
Local Citation Building
Focus on quality over quantity. Target directories that are relevant to your industry and location. Make sure all listings include complete business information and link back to your website where possible.
Month 5: Expanding Your Content Growth
Quality Content Creation
Pump out two more blog posts, but make them count. Target those questions customers keep asking you – it positions you as the expert while boosting your building online presence with genuinely useful content. Refresh your website with new services or recent work. Keep chasing those Google reviews too.
Content Optimization Strategy
Research keywords your customers actually use. Tools like SEO keyword research guide help identify opportunities. Focus on long-tail keywords that match customer intent rather than highly competitive generic terms.
Month 6: Performance Review and Future Planning
Data-Driven Decision Making
Time for a proper deep dive into your numbers. Which pages are performing best? Where's your traffic coming from? What keywords are you starting to rank for? This data becomes gold for planning your next six months of content and marketing moves.
Setting Future Goals
Based on your six-month performance data, set realistic targets for the next phase. Identify which strategies delivered the best ROI and double down on those. Create a content calendar that addresses seasonal trends and customer needs throughout the year.
